GNU/Linux et les DVDs : y'a pas moyen ! [MàJ] - Multimédia - Linux et OS Alternatifs
Marsh Posté le 27-09-2003 à 19:14:17
quand tu fais un top c'est quel prog qui utilise un max de cpu ? (question sans doute débile puisqu'il doit s'agir du player video, mais ne sait-on jamais ...)
et si tu vire le dvdrom de l'émulation scsi histoire de faire un test ça donne quoi ?
Marsh Posté le 27-09-2003 à 19:17:10
FlamM a écrit : quand tu fais un top c'est quel prog qui utilise un max de cpu ? (question sans doute débile puisqu'il doit s'agir du player video, mais ne sait-on jamais ...) |
Bien sur que c'est le prog video qui bouffe tout...
Avec ou sans émulation SCSI c'est pareil ; j'ai mis l'émulation SCSI pour un pouvoir graver de disque à disque avec cdrecord.
Je précise que le PC met + ou - 30 secondes avant de planater complètement.
Marsh Posté le 27-09-2003 à 23:08:09
Tu as toutes les libs qu'il faut pour lire les DVD cryptés??
Marsh Posté le 27-09-2003 à 23:16:23
BlindMan a écrit : Tu as toutes les libs qu'il faut pour lire les DVD cryptés?? |
Bien sur que oui...
ça bloque sur l'utilisation de libdvdcss.
Marsh Posté le 28-09-2003 à 00:42:48
bien venu au club .
c quoi ton cpu ?
moi ca fesait ca sur un p3 450 .
Désormais j'utilise ogle avec les options mmx et ca marche .
Tous les autres lecteurs dvd me fesaient les meme symptomes que toi , meme mplayer qui est réputé pour etre léger, sans parler de vlc.
Marsh Posté le 28-09-2003 à 09:25:31
psebcopathe a écrit : bien venu au club . |
Copaing !
Mon CPU est AMD Athlon 1400 Tbird non OC.
La variable use de mon make.conf contient l'option MMX.
Je vais retester avec ogle...
Marsh Posté le 28-09-2003 à 09:39:33
ça marche pas...reboot du Pc avant freeze total obligatoire...
Bon, une autre idée ?
Marsh Posté le 28-09-2003 à 09:45:11
C'est vrai que j'ai juste testé avec des DVDs cryptés...
Marsh Posté le 28-09-2003 à 10:21:27
Si vraiment t'es sûr de ton coup, tu peux faire un rapport de bug à http://bugzilla.videolan.org/cgi-b [...] er_bug.cgi ou alors essayer de joindre les dev (certains sont français) sur l'IRC #videolan sur FreeNode.net
Marsh Posté le 28-09-2003 à 11:20:16
apparament il a tout tenté
sinon, tu as essayé en utilisant un autre mode de sortie video , a la place de xv essai avec sdl ou x11.
Si ca marche c qu'il faut mettre tes drivers videos a jour avec les drivers proprio ati.
Marsh Posté le 28-09-2003 à 12:52:59
[Madko] a écrit : pourquoi il utilise videolan??? |
C'est juste que la libdvdcss est hébergée chez VideoLAN. Mais elle n'est pas développée que par eux, Xine et MPlayer s'en servent
Marsh Posté le 04-11-2003 à 19:55:07
Du nouveau :
Code :
|
Maintenant ça plante plus, ça mouline pendant 20-30 secondes, depuis que j'ai changé le firmware du lecteur (et passer en RPC-1 tant qu'à faire ). Y'a un rapport d'après vous ?
Au fait : libdvdcss 1.2.8
Marsh Posté le 04-11-2003 à 19:58:50
tu as bien un lien symbolique du device de ton DVD vers /dev/dvd ?
Marsh Posté le 04-11-2003 à 20:01:13
Code :
|
Il est émulé en SCSI pour je sais plus quel soft de gravure (mais c'est pareil en IDE pur).
Marsh Posté le 04-11-2003 à 20:01:16
http://linux-wizard.tuxfamily.org/ [...] .html#xine
Marsh Posté le 04-11-2003 à 20:02:11
tu es sûr du devices ?
Marsh Posté le 04-11-2003 à 20:03:13
Je tenais à préciser que la plupart des DVDs cryptés se vautrent sauf 1 ou 2 qui passent.
Marsh Posté le 04-11-2003 à 20:04:08
Dark_Schneider a écrit : tu es sûr du devices ? |
J'ai même essayé sans lien symbolique.
Marsh Posté le 04-11-2003 à 20:08:25
désactive/enlève le rw device ( dans xine il faut enlever /dev/raw )
Marsh Posté le 04-11-2003 à 20:09:06
déjà évite l'mulation SCSI, ça évitera les plantages avec les_led_du_clavier_en_sapin_de_noël
sinon mplayer contient tout ce qu'il faut en interne pour lire les DVD (même css je crois), faut désactiver les libs externes à la compile...
enfin, ton noyau supporte-t-il l'UDF ? peux-tu monter un DVD ?
edit : pour mplayer, le miens (1.0 pre2) est compilé avec : --disable-mpdvdkit --disable-dvdread, il utilise le "décodeur en interne"
Marsh Posté le 04-11-2003 à 20:12:52
Dark_Schneider a écrit : désactive/enlève le rw device ( dans xine il faut enlever /dev/raw ) |
Même sans :
Code :
|
Marsh Posté le 04-11-2003 à 20:14:39
BMOTheKiller a écrit : déjà évite l'mulation SCSI, ça évitera les plantages avec les_led_du_clavier_en_sapin_de_noël |
Je réessaierai sans émulation SCSI.
Oui je peux monter un DVD en lecture.
Je vais compiler mplayer un autre jour avec tes options.
Marsh Posté le 04-11-2003 à 20:19:43
Dans un des topic sur les forums gentoo, il est explique que parfois ca plante quand on fait de l'emulation scsi sur un lecteur IDE/ATAPI cdrom/dvd. (tape writer dans leur moteur de recherche, tu trouveras un enorme topic sur les graveurs)
A ta place, je verifierai que tu ne fais pas de l'emulation scsi sur ton lecteur dvd.
Sur ma config :
le dvd :
Code :
|
et pour mon graveur IDE
Code :
|
dans grub :
Code :
|
tu remarqueras que j'ai force la reconnaissance du dvd en tant qu'interface IDE/ATAPI avec le module ide-cdrom et l'emulation scsi de mon graveur de cdrom IDE.
edit : n'oublie pas de jeter un oeil dans ton /etc/devfsd.conf
Marsh Posté le 04-11-2003 à 20:32:08
mirtouf a écrit :
|
Il ne faut pas monter ton lecteur dvd pour la lecture avec xine, sinon tu auras ce message d'erreur.
Meme chose pour les cd-audio, sauf que dans ce cas, ce n'est meme pas possible de les monter tout court.
Marsh Posté le 04-11-2003 à 21:08:59
Non je ne monte pas mon lecteur de DVD, j'ai eu ce message sans le monter.
Oui j'ai les permissions qu'il faut sur mes devices.
|
Au fait on peut monter un CD audio mais je sais plus comment on fait.
Marsh Posté le 04-11-2003 à 21:31:50
patch CDFS et AudioFS, ils en parlent ici : http://old.lwn.net/2000/0406/kernel.php3
Marsh Posté le 04-11-2003 à 21:53:24
Je viens de faire un tour sur les forums gentoo : Y'avait un gars avec le même problème (même messages d'erreurs).
Solution : changer de lecteur de DVD....
Marsh Posté le 04-11-2003 à 21:57:33
encore ça va tu en as 2, donc la possibilité de tester est simple
avoir ce problème sur 2 lecteurs différents, ça me paraitrait un peu louche quand même....
Marsh Posté le 04-11-2003 à 23:47:01
bash-2.05b# lspci |
[~] > cdrecord -scanbus |
Extrait de grub.conf :
title=Gentoo (2.4.20-gentoo-r8) |
Extrait de fstab :
/dev/scsi/host0/bus0/target0/lun0/cd /mnt/cdrom auto user,noauto,ro,iocharset=iso8859-15,codepage=850,umask=0 0 0 |
Sinon, mplayer (1.0_pre2) est installé en instable, Xine (0.9.21) avec ttes les dépendances en instable.
Pas de problèmes tt fctionne très bien (dri actif via les pilotes libres).
Lien symbolique pour le DVD :
[~] > ls -l /dev/dvd |
Je préfère Xine pour la lecture des DVDs (plus d'options ds le gui).
Marsh Posté le 05-11-2003 à 10:26:18
A l'heure actuelle je penche pour un problème de lecteur DVD.
Marsh Posté le 05-11-2003 à 20:32:42
Malgré tous vos bons conseils cela ne passe toujours pas.
Y'a qu'un DVD qui a bien voulu passer jusque là...
Marsh Posté le 05-11-2003 à 20:35:43
et si tu vires l'émulation SCSI ? ça marche pas non plus ?
Marsh Posté le 05-11-2003 à 21:04:14
Avec ou sans émulation SCSI c'est pareil.
Changementde lecteur pas encore testé : c'était le gars du forum gentoo qui l'avait fait sur son PC.
Marque du lecteur Artec (Ultima c'est pareil).
Marsh Posté le 05-11-2003 à 21:09:05
mirtouf a écrit : Malgré tous vos bons conseils cela ne passe toujours pas. |
Je penche pour un problèmes de dépendances entre les libdvdread+libdvdcss et Xine-lib. Exemple ci-dessous :
J'ai eu les mêmes problèmes. Je me suis rendu compte que la plupart des applications telles Xine et Ogle à l'heure actuelle (qui est le meilleur pour lire les dvd), utilisent LIBDVDCSS2 c'est-à-dire 1.2.4) et non LIBDVDCSS3 (version 1.2.8). pour Xine 0.9.13 (Même remarque pour libdvdread (Utiliser LIBDVDREAD2)) . Pour les versions récentes de Xine, je n'ai pas vérifié.
Mplayer fait exception à ces règles des dépendances puisqu'il possède un libdvdcss et libdvdread intégré.
Marsh Posté le 27-09-2003 à 17:57:58
Bonjour, il y quelque chose qui me manque sur mon 1er PC (cf. config) c'est bien la lecture des DVDs video.
Je m'explique :
A chaque fois que je veux commencer la lecture le système commence obtient un taux d'occupation CPU de 100 % puis finit par se vautrer complètement (les magic keys ne fonctionnent même plus).
Bien evidemment cela le fait avec tous les players de DVD sous disponibles sous ma Gentoo 1.4
J'ai testé plusieurs noyaux (2.4.21 et .22 à la vanille ainsi que les 2.4.20-gentoo-r5 et r6) mais le résultat reste invariablement et désepérement le même.
Bien évidemment le DMA est activé pour tous les prériphériques IDE et la lecture des DVD fonctionne impec sous Win....
Et les logs du kernel n'indiquent RIEN !
Mes question :
1- Mon lecteur ou tout autre partie de mon matos poserait-il problème au noyau ?
2- Avez-vous déjà rencontrer un problème similaire ?
Quelques infos supplémentaires sur mon matériel :
# lspci
00:00.0 Host bridge: VIA Technologies, Inc. VT8366/A/7 [Apollo KT266/A/333]
00:01.0 PCI bridge: VIA Technologies, Inc. VT8366/A/7 [Apollo KT266/A/333 AGP]
00:06.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L-8139/8139C/8139C+ (rev 10)
00:08.0 Multimedia video controller: Brooktree Corporation Bt878 Video Capture (rev 11)
00:08.1 Multimedia controller: Brooktree Corporation Bt878 Audio Capture (rev 11)
00:11.0 ISA bridge: VIA Technologies, Inc. VT8233 PCI to ISA Bridge
00:11.1 IDE interface: VIA Technologies, Inc. VT82C586A/B/VT82C686/A/B/VT8233/A/C/VT8235 PIPC Bus Master IDE (rev 06)
00:11.2 USB Controller: VIA Technologies, Inc. USB (rev 1b)
00:11.3 USB Controller: VIA Technologies, Inc. USB (rev 1b)
00:11.4 USB Controller: VIA Technologies, Inc. USB (rev 1b)
00:11.5 Multimedia audio controller: VIA Technologies, Inc. VT8233/A/8235 AC97 Audio Controller (rev 10)
01:00.0 VGA compatible controller: ATI Technologies Inc Radeon R250 If [Radeon 9000] (rev 01)
01:00.1 Display controller: ATI Technologies Inc Radeon R250 [Radeon 9000] (Secondary) (rev 01)
# cdrecord -scanbus
Cdrecord 2.01a14 (i686-pc-linux-gnu) Copyright (C) 1995-2003 Jörg Schilling
Linux sg driver version: 3.1.24
Using libscg version 'schily-0.7'
scsibus0:
0,0,0 0) 'IDE ' 'DVD-ROM 16X ' '1.06' Removable CD-ROM
0,1,0 1) ' ' 'RW-241040 ' '1.02' Removable CD-ROM
Et émulation SCSI pour tout le monde
Sur ce coup-là j'ai vraiment besoin de votre aide...
Salut !
Message édité par mirtouf le 07-11-2003 à 22:56:58
---------------
-~- Libérez Datoune ! -~- Camarade, toi aussi rejoins le FLD pour que la flamme de la Révolution ne s'éteigne pas ! -~- A VENDRE